Game Overview
The Trap Adventure 2 game is a troll-style precision platformer built around hidden dangers and repeated retries. You guide a small character through short stages that are packed with fake safety cues, sudden spikes, and movement traps designed to catch players who rush. At first, it can feel unfair, but the real challenge is learning how the game thinks. Once you start expecting tricks, the design becomes a puzzle of timing and route memory.
What makes it so addictive is the way progress happens in tiny steps. You do not usually win by reacting faster than in a normal platform game. You win by recognizing patterns, testing suspicious areas, and moving with intention. Sections that seem impossible at the start become manageable after a few tries, and that shift creates a strong sense of improvement. It is a great choice for players who enjoy hard platform games, "gotcha" traps, and challenge runs that reward patience.
Depending on the version you play, controls and interface details may vary a little, but the core experience stays the same: expect surprises, restart often, and use each failure as information for the next attempt.

Tips for Beginners
- Move slowly at first: Suspicious ground, ceilings, and "easy" jumps are often bait.
- Watch what triggered the trap: Learn whether it was position, timing, or jump height.
- Take mental notes: Remember exact danger spots so your next run starts stronger.
Advanced Tips
- Bait traps safely: Approach edges carefully to trigger hidden hazards before committing.
- Use consistent jump timing: Repeating the same rhythm helps on sections that require precision.
- Break levels into segments: Master one sequence at a time instead of trying to finish in one perfect run.
Common Mistakes
- Trusting visual cues too much: "Safe" platforms and obvious routes are often designed to trick you.
- Rushing after a reset: Frustration leads to repeated mistakes and missed learning moments.
- Changing timing every try: Random movement makes it harder to figure out what actually works.

Who made Trap Adventure 2?
Trap Adventure 2 was created by Hiroyoshi Oshiba, also known as hiro!!jaca, and it became well known for its brutal "trap" platforming design and reaction videos shared online.
